## Telemetry Payload Compression

The Murkwater pipeline compresses telemetry payloads with zstd (level 6) before they land in cold storage. Compression dictionaries are rotated weekly and versioned, so decompression of historical payloads requires the matching dictionary record. Dictionaries and rotation metadata live in a dedicated store, reachable via the connection string below.

primary connection of yagep-kahip = redis://giliel_svc:zYiKsLL2PLpfPL@db-348f.xolmarsys.corp:5432/fenwyn

# Hey, welcome aboard! Quick context on report exports at Pinefold.
# All timestamps are stored UTC; the exporter converts to the customer's
# zone using REPORT_TZ_DEFAULT below. Don't hardcode offsets — Daylight
# shifts in the Varenmoor region burned us twice last year.
# The exporter signs download links with a secret that this file sets on
# the very next line.

vault entry, yahif-yajep: COURIER_KEY29=b802bdf8034096b65a51c6ba5abe2

## Tuning

If your plugin schedules jobs through the Tidewick cron host, be aware that our drift investigation found skew accumulating when hooks run longer than the tick interval. Plugins should respect the grace and catch-up limits rather than re-scheduling themselves. The values the scheduler currently enforces are shown below.

tuning table, yajog-yahof:
BUDGETS = {
    "lamvan": 303,
    "wenox": 460,
    "fenvan": 525,
}

Heads up for the cut: the Furrowlink gateway now batches telemetry from combines instead of streaming per-sensor. Field radios in the Dunmere pilot drop out constantly, so the batcher holds readings and flushes on size or age, whichever hits first. Worst-case staleness is about ninety seconds, which agronomy signed off on. Ship it with the following tuning constants.

limits module of fajog-kahag:
QUOTAS = {
    "druael": 1,
    "zorath": 10,
    "druath": 1,
    "druwyn": 5,
}